> > > > Is there some equivalent mechanism that lets dlloaded
> > > > plugins dig function pointers out of the the host? Thier
> > > > public symbol linking system is backward too from what I
> > > > remember.
> > >
> > > one portable way is to pass a struct of function pointers
> > > filled by the host to the plugin initialization function, as
> > > done in the SuperCollider server plugin API.
> >
> > That doesn't really help for extensions.
>
> It does if the struct looks like this:
>
> struct ExtensionFunctions {
> struct {
> const char* extension_uri;
> void* function_pointer;
> }* null_terminated_function_array;
> };

I don't like the function pointer specific nature of it.

Simpler:

struct HostFeature {
    const char* feature_uri;
    void* data;
};

This allows the host to pass anything to the plugin, function pointer,
struct of some useful data, pointer to some shared resource, etc. etc.
